Small-business AI coaching priorities

Find repeated work Look for tasks that happen every week and consume owner or admin time.
Keep data safe Set clear rules for customer information, financial details, and private business records.
Improve one workflow Start with a narrow task such as enquiry replies, proposals, FAQs, or meeting summaries.
Create templates Turn successful examples into reusable prompts and checklists.
Review the return Measure time saved, quality improved, and whether the workflow is easy to repeat.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Trying too many tools before one workflow is working reliably.
  • Putting private customer or financial data into public AI tools without rules.
  • Using AI only for marketing ideas and ignoring operational workflows.

FAQ

What is the best first AI use case for a small business?

A good first use case is a repeated, low-risk task such as drafting customer replies, summarising meetings, improving FAQs, or preparing marketing outlines.

Do small businesses need custom AI tools?

Usually not at first. Most small businesses should begin with clear workflows using approved tools before considering custom automation.

How can AI coaching reduce risk?

Coaching helps owners set data rules, verify outputs, and avoid using AI in areas where mistakes would be costly.
